Cut the one cable of the 4 pin fan and connect the + and - wires to the coressponding powersupply holes.
Attach the 3D printed fan holder to the outer ends of the coolermaster fan.

I just ordered the parts myself in Europe and the coolermaster fan is cheaper here but I think it'll look clean and work more effective than the solutions on the market now.


Parts to get:

Cooler Master MasterFan SF360R
SoulBay 30W Universal AC/DC Adapter Switching Power Supply with 8 Selectable Adapter Tips on Amazon?
 
Nice idea. I'd spend a few extra dollars and get a Noctua IP-65 or IP-68 rated fan, though. It will last much longer.
 
Done and installed guys, can ziptie the 1 wire behind the fan mount for a cleaner look. Fans are supersilent and move alot of air.
